Section 17110.

CA Welf & Inst Code § 17110 (2016) What's This?

17110. Whenever the respective boards of supervisors deem it best for the welfare of a family or in the public interest that an indigent remain in a county not responsible for his support, the county responsible for the support of the indigent may agree to support him in the county not so responsible; but no indigent supported in this manner shall be deemed to have acquired a residence in the nonresponsible county. Such agreement shall be made by the responsible county with the nonresponsible county, and a record or copy thereof shall be sent to and filed in the office of the department.

(Added by Stats. 1965, Ch. 1784.)
